BIA requires standardized dimension conditions to protect accuracy and precision. Customers should preserve regular hydration condition, skin temperature level, and size of time given that exercise. For that reason, dehydrated people display a body fat percent deceivingly greater than the real percentage. On top of that, skin temperature level can alter impedance; a warmer skin temperature level lowers impedance and leads to a reduced forecasted body fat portion. Strength and power professional athletes such as American football players, wrestlers, and various other combat athletes; powerlifters; bodybuilders; weightlifters; and track and field throwers profit considerably from high degrees of lean body mass. Endurance professional athletes such as distance runners, cyclists, and triathletes profit greatly from having reduced percent body fat. Professional athletes such as gymnasts, wrestlers, high jumpers, post vaulters, fighters, mixed martial musicians, and weightlifters benefit greatly from having a high strength-to-mass (and power-to-mass) ratio.
